Dãy con tăng dài nhất


Gửi bài giải

Điểm: 5
Giới hạn thời gian: 1.0s
Giới hạn bộ nhớ: 256M

Tác giả:
Kiểu bài tập

Đề bài

Cho một dãy số nguyên gồm $N$ phần tử$A_1, A_2, ..., A_N$. Hãy tìm độ dài của dãy con tăng dài nhất (không cần liên tiếp) của dãy số đã cho.

Dãy con tăng là dãy $A_{i_1}, A_{i_2},..., A_{i_k}$ sao cho $i_1 < i_2 < ... < i_k$ và $A_{i_1} < A_{i_2}< ... < A_{i_k}$.

Dữ liệu vào

Dòng 1: Số nguyên dương $N$ ($1 \le N \le 1000$). Dòng 2: Dãy số $A$ gồm $N$ số nguyên ($|A_i| \le 10^9$).

Dữ liệu ra

Một số nguyên duy nhất là độ dài dãy con tăng dài nhất.

Ví dụ

Input Output
6
1 2 5 4 6 2
4
5
1 2 3 4 5
5

Nhận xét

Không có ý kiến tại thời điểm này.